One of the most popular venues for poetry events in Bristol is the Bristol Poetry Institute, located at the University of Bristol The institute hosts a variety of events throughout the year, including readings, workshops, and lectures by acclaimed poets These events are open to the public and are a great way to immerse yourself in the world of poetry and meet like-minded individuals who share a passion for the written word.
In addition to the Bristol Poetry Institute, there are a number of other venues in the city that regularly host poetry events The Crofters Rights, a popular bar and music venue in the Stokes Croft neighborhood, hosts a monthly poetry slam where poets can compete for cash prizes and recognition This event is a favorite among local poets and poetry enthusiasts, as it provides a platform for emerging poets to showcase their work and connect with other members of the poetry community.
Another popular poetry event in Bristol is the Milk Poetry Open Mic Night, held at the Milk Bar in the city center This event is open to poets of all levels, from beginners to seasoned professionals, and provides a supportive and welcoming environment for poets to share their work and receive feedback from their peers The open mic nights at Milk Bar are always a fun and lively affair, with a diverse range of styles and voices on display.
